That only works if you have a thing called "personal" on your policy. And these rates go up depending on how much "personal" you add. If you want to insure 10k worth of personal on your car, your rate will go up drastically. And from there, if it does get stolen, you have to supply legitament receipts for all parts covered and they have to be dated after your coverage begins.
